Architect/Architectural Designer - REMOTE - 100K PLUS

Worldwide Salaried Open

Collaborating with a team of designers and engineers as Architect/Architectural Designer, you’ll help us engage with clients and subcontractors, designing some of the world’s most advanced data center facilities. Your multi-discipline, highly interactive team will work together to deliver construction documents.

Responsibilities

Plan and conduct work requiring judgment and evaluation, selection, and adaptation of architectural techniques and criteria. Exhibit a high level of attention to detail and quality control. Perform calculation checking of others’ work. Collaborate with other designers in the development of layout, technical design, construction drawings, specification, and model creation. Attend project meetings and take an active role in helping the team resolve concerns and solve problems across all disciplines. Participate in and champion internal, cross-discipline, and external project quality reviews. Support field construction efforts, including reviewing submittals, responding to questions from clients and contractors, and performing field walks. Perform technical and business presentations with clients and employees. Perform quality reviews on designs performed by others. Participate in developing proposals, budgets, and schedules for process-specific work. Bring your passion for innovation, ambitious spirit, and expertise. We’ll help you thrive, pursue, and fulfill what inspires you – so we can make big impacts on the world together.

Qualifications

Bachelor’s degree in Architecture from an accredited Architectural program. Professional Architectural License and be able to be licensed in multiple states. 1-2 years of professional Architectural Design experience. Expert-level proficiency with REVIT, AutoCAD, Sketchup, and Adobe Suite. Knowledge of building codes and applicability to industrial facilities. Understanding of scopes of work, developing budgets, and reviewing schedules. Ability to work well across multiple teams and lead small architectural teams.

Preferred Qualifications
